We're using the fab Itty Bitty Chistmas Stamp Set and Dies.  It's an all sentiment set, which to be honest, is super useful sometimes.

I've made 3 cards.
The first with the beginner stamper in mind, who may not have the dies.


Then the casual crafter who may have the dies and some punches.


Then the final card for the avid crafter who may have some additional embellishments,


All the cards feature the fine tip glue pen that can create beautiful dew drop like spots and extra shine to different elements.
